Brief Summary
Osteoarthritis (OA) is a common cause of pain and disability. Physical therapy is a key part of treatment for OA, but VA Medical Centers are often limited in their capacity to provide physical therapy...

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Radiographic Evidence of Knee Osteoarthritis and a Clinician's Diagnosis
- Current knee symptoms
Exclusion
- Presence of other rheumatological conditions (such as rheumatoid arthritis and fibromyalgia) - Other health-related problem that would prevent safe participation in a physical therapy program - Currently undergoing physical therapy for knee OA, participation in another interventional study, scheduled or on waiting list for joint replacement surgery, resident of nursing home
